Output 668332422f3227c18412d26aa4ddf75bffb424f665b2d51d4315cdcd49c155cb:1

value
262280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 501640710ffcd86a20d1effe044a51ba19df00ab OP_EQUAL
address
38zUdy3mu25GQg14vLCHFP9AcHfrWUGDEM
transaction
668332422f3227c18412d26aa4ddf75bffb424f665b2d51d4315cdcd49c155cb
spent
true